Bug 23706 – Do not escape POSIX shell parameters unless necessary
Status
RESOLVED
Resolution
FIXED
Severity
enhancement
Priority
P1
Component
phobos
Product
D
Version
D2
Platform
All
OS
Linux
Creation time
2023-02-14T13:55:12Z
Last change time
2023-02-15T09:26:10Z
Keywords
pull
Assigned to
No Owner
Creator
Vladimir Panteleev
Comments
Comment #0 by dlang-bugzilla — 2023-02-14T13:55:12Z
We should apply the same idea as issue 13447 to POSIX shell escaping as well.
Comment #1 by dlang-bot — 2023-02-14T14:18:31Z
@CyberShadow created dlang/phobos pull request #8684 "Fix Issue 23706 - Do not escape POSIX shell parameters unless necessary" fixing this issue:
- Fix Issue 23706 - Do not escape POSIX shell parameters unless necessary
POSIX follow-up to Issue 13447 / 09a0b876c87cec6bb7af62b55179aff745b203dc.
https://github.com/dlang/phobos/pull/8684
Comment #2 by dlang-bot — 2023-02-15T09:26:10Z
dlang/phobos pull request #8684 "Fix Issue 23706 - Do not escape POSIX shell parameters unless necessary" was merged into master:
- fdceb11b3b30a5dbea9e1159acbbe8642537d5f3 by Vladimir Panteleev:
Fix Issue 23706 - Do not escape POSIX shell parameters unless necessary
POSIX follow-up to Issue 13447 / 09a0b876c87cec6bb7af62b55179aff745b203dc.
https://github.com/dlang/phobos/pull/8684